Moldovan authorities urge citizens to avoid any travel to Israel

The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Moldova has issued a travel alert - Avoid any travel - for the State of Israel, in the context of the security situation in the Middle East. Additionally, a Crisis Cell has been activated.

According to the MFA, Moldovan citizens already on Israeli territory are urged to exercise maximum caution and strictly follow the authorities' instructions.

Airports in Israel, including Ben Gurion have temporarily suspended operations. Furthermore, seaports and land border crossings between Israel and Egypt and Jordan are closed or blocked.

The MFA has issued urgent recommendations for Moldovan citizens in Israel: to strictly adhere to the instructions of local authorities; to stay near air raid shelters; to avoid non-essential travel, especially in the north and south of the country; to avoid crowded areas, public transport, and shopping centers; to constantly consult the official information from the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Tel Aviv and Israeli authorities.

Citizens can request consular assistance at the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Israel or the emergency line: +972 52-7789772.

The MFA announces that it continuously monitors developments in the region and remains prepared to support affected Moldovan citizens.

Israel carried out strikes on Friday against Iran, suspected of seeking to acquire nuclear weapons. Iran warned that it has the "legal and legitimate right" to respond to Israel's deadly attacks on several cities and the country's nuclear facilities.
